Cattier: The Quintessence of Premier Cru Terroirs in Chigny-les-Roses

Established since 1763 in the renowned terroir of Chigny-les-Roses, Maison Cattier is one of the oldest and most respected family-owned houses in the Montagne de Reims. With artisanal expertise passed down through thirteen generations, this independent house excels in the art of crafting Premier Cru cuvées of unparalleled richness, fruitiness, and consistency.

A family legacy and a unique underground heritage

Today, the House proudly upholds its high standards under the leadership of Alexandre Cattier, who embodies the estate’s winemaking expertise. The vineyard spans some thirty hectares, ideally situated in the heart of the Montagne de Reims, where Pinot Meunier and Pinot Noir find their ideal terroir. One of the house’s greatest treasures lies underground: its cuvées age in historic chalk cellars among the deepest in the region, dug out over four levels to provide absolute freshness during aging.

The art of balance and sustainable viticulture

The strength of Cattier champagnes lies in their masterfully balanced vinosity and innate richness. A pioneer in eco-responsible viticulture (HVE-certified), the house prioritizes rigorous soil management to preserve the fruit’s brilliance. While the family’s elite technical expertise is celebrated worldwide—it notably oversees the production of the famous Armand de Brignac prestige cuvées—the eponymous range stands out for its silky texture and remarkably satiny bubbles, born of long aging in the cellar.

Description Cattier Clos du Moulin.

Produced from a historic vineyard of just 2.2 hectares located in the heart of the Montagne de Reims, near Chigny-les-Roses, Clos du Moulin is one of the most prestigious cuvées from the Cattier house. This rare, perfectly exposed terroir gives rise to a champagne of great character, crafted from a blend of three vintages carefully selected for their quality and aging potential. Aged for over six years in the cellar, then enhanced by a liqueur made from a wine aged for one year in oak barrels, this champagne develops remarkable depth while retaining impressive energy and precision. Each numbered bottle attests to the exclusive and intimate nature of this cuvée. The moderate dosage of 6 g/L perfectly preserves the balance between fullness and freshness.

The color is a brilliant golden yellow. The effervescence, regular and delicate, forms an elegant stream of fine bubbles that immediately highlights the wine’s refinement. The nose impresses with its richness and aromatic complexity. The bouquet blends intense notes of white peach, ripe melon, wild strawberry, blackcurrant, and fresh apple with more exotic nuances of passion fruit, mango, and lychee. Upon aeration, more indulgent hints of fig jam and rhubarb emerge, accompanied by subtle spicy notes of vanilla and cinnamon that add depth and sophistication. The attack on the palate is lively, taut, and particularly dynamic, carried by a lovely citrus freshness reminiscent of lemon and grapefruit. Very quickly, the texture gains in fullness and creaminess, revealing flavors of fresh raspberry, crisp white fruits, and ripe pineapple, enhanced by a light exotic touch of passion fruit. The wine perfectly balances energy, richness, and precision. The long, harmonious finish prolongs the sensations with refined notes of lightly caramelized pear, toasted hazelnut, and a delicate creamy touch that lends great elegance.

The ultimate gastronomic champagne, Clos du Moulin is the ideal accompaniment to delicate fish with light, airy sauces, as well as delicate cheeses such as a lightly aged tomme. Its freshness and complexity also make it a remarkable pairing for fruit desserts, light tarts, or lightly sweetened ice creams.

Founded in 1971, the Club Trésors de Champagne is a very exclusive circle that brings together 25 of the region’s finest artisan winemakers. United by a love for their terroir, respect for traditional craftsmanship, and a vision for the future, these exceptional winemakers have been rigorously selected for the excellence of their work. Membership in the club is granted only upon sponsorship by one or more existing members.

For them, champagne is not just a celebratory drink; it is a unique story told through every bottle.

The “Spécial Club” cuvée

Being a member of this highly exclusiveclub allows winemakers to produce a unique, vintage-dated prestige cuvée: the Spécial Club. Recognized as the ultimate symbol of their expertise, this cuvée undergoes a rigorous process to ensure impeccable quality.

To earn this coveted “label,” each bottle must pass through rigorous stages:

  • Ultra-strict specifications demanding authenticity and perfection.
  • Two successive blind tastings, conducted by a jury of five independent oenologists.
  • A unanimous verdict: The quality of the cuvée must receive the absolute unanimous approval of the jury to be entitled to bear the name “Spécial Club.”
